[Wi-Fi] Do not delete certs when forgetting network
Deleting EAP Wi-Fi configuration deletes shared credentials used by other
configs. To resolve this issue the following changes were implemented:
1. When manually adding Wi-Fi certs from storage, Wi-Fi will not attempt
to delete them when network is removed.
2. When apps use WifiEnterpriseConfig#setClientKeyEntry to add certs,
they will be deleted if the network is removed.
3. Allow the user to delete Wi-Fi certs the same way that allows the
user to add them. Make the "Remove" option available, and implement key
store removal in settings.
Bug: 30248175
Test: atest WifiEnterpriseConfigTest
Test: Load certs, remove certs from credentials menu
Test: Load cert, create 2 EAP networks that use it, forget one network
